VerticalAlignment

VerticalAlignment enumeration

Especifica la alineación vertical de una forma flotante, un marco de texto o una tabla flotante.

public enum VerticalAlignment

Valores

NombreValorDescripción
None0El objeto se posiciona explícitamente, generalmente usando suArriba propiedad.
Top1Especifica que el objeto estará en la parte superior de la base de alineación vertical.
Center2Especifica que el objeto estará centrado con respecto a la base de alineación vertical.
Bottom3Especifica que el objeto estará en la parte inferior de la base de alineación vertical.
Inside4Especifica que el objeto estará dentro de la base de alineación horizontal.
Outside5Especifica que el objeto estará fuera de la base de alineación vertical.
Inline-1No documentado. Parece ser un valor posible para tablas y párrafos flotantes.
Default0Igual queNone .

Ejemplos

Muestra cómo insertar una imagen flotante en el centro de una página.

Document doc = new Document();
DocumentBuilder builder = new DocumentBuilder(doc);

// Inserta una imagen flotante que aparecerá detrás del texto superpuesto y alinéala con el centro de la página.
Shape shape = builder.InsertImage(ImageDir + "Logo.jpg");
shape.WrapType = WrapType.None;
shape.BehindText = true;
shape.RelativeHorizontalPosition = RelativeHorizontalPosition.Page;
shape.RelativeVerticalPosition = RelativeVerticalPosition.Page;
shape.HorizontalAlignment = HorizontalAlignment.Center;
shape.VerticalAlignment = VerticalAlignment.Center;

doc.Save(ArtifactsDir + "Image.CreateFloatingPageCenter.docx");

Ver también